What is technology acceptable use policy?
A technology acceptable use policy is a set of regulations that outline the proper use of technology resources within an organization, detailing what is considered acceptable and unacceptable behavior.
Who is required to file technology acceptable use policy?
Employees, contractors, and any individuals who access or use the organization's technology resources are typically required to acknowledge and comply with the technology acceptable use policy.

What is the purpose of technology acceptable use policy?
The purpose of the technology acceptable use policy is to protect the organization's technology resources, ensure security, enhance productivity, and clarify the expected behavior of users.
